Ronald graduated from Prior Park College, Bath, England in 1975 with a diverse background in Commerce and Art. He secured his citizenship to the United States on May 19, 2000.

He has studied at the Fashion Institute of Technology and started his own Interior Design service, Design in Display. Providing Interior Design/Visual Merchandising services in New Jersey and New York City for 7+ years. Ronald also was one of the first interior designers to work with the design house, Donghia out of the D&D Building, providing personal in home interior design services in New York City.

For the past 20 years he has made peace (with himself and a few clients), as a Licensed Mortgage Banker, Licensed REALTOR and Appraiser. Over his career, Ronald has received Senate Citations, requests to work with various New Jersey State Departments on housing initiatives and referred to the New Jersey Department of Community Affairs to provide technical assistance on housing issues. He has taught as an adjunct facility teacher at two County Colleges, conducted classes on Home Ownership, Credit and Financial Literacy, Predatory Lending and Licensing for state compliance. He has worked with and on many initiatives.

As the CEO of Managing Change, LLC, Ronald provides consultative services as a business consulting on Organizational and Enterprise Change Management. He is an Educator/Coach/Trainer and is credited with publishing 4 books. Most notable, My Castle, My Jail, Home ownership Has Never Been Easier to Lose. What Ever Happened to the American Dream? He is frequently heard presenting Keynote talks and workshop forums on the topic of Managing Change Successfully. His primary experience has been in the Financial Services, Mortgage Banking and Telecommunications and Customer Services industries.
